Household of Joannis Gerardi Cuijs

He is married to Hendrina van der Sterren.

They got married on February 11, 1721 at Onsenoort, Noord-Brabant, Nederland, he was 24 years old.Source 1


Child(ren):

  1. Petronilla Cuys  1724-???? 
  2. Adrianus Kuijs  1726-1804 
  3. Elisabeth Kuijs  1727-1728
  4. Gerardus Kuijs  1729-1736
  5. Joannes Kuys  1731-1812 
  6. Gerardus Kuys  1737-1786
